In 1295, Elizabeth de Clare entered the world in Tewkesbury, Gloucestershire, England, born to Gilbert De Clare 7Th Earl Of Gloucester And Joan Of Acre Plantagenet. Elizabeth de Clare married John De Burgh, Roger Damory, and had children including Eleanor Damory, Idabel De Verdun, William Donn De Burgh 3Rd Earl Of Ulster 4Th Baron Of Cannaught. Elizabeth de Clare passed away in 1360 in Aldgate, City of London, Greater London, England.
